Eaves Maintenance: A Comprehensive Guide for Homeowners
Eaves are an integral part of a home's roofing system, serving not only an aesthetic purpose however also a practical one. They assist direct rainwater far from your house's foundation, avoiding potential damage and leakages. As such, appropriate maintenance of eaves is important for the longevity and integrity of a home. Significance of Eaves Maintenance
The eaves are located at the edge of the roofing, extending beyond the walls of your home. Their primary functions include:
Water Diversion: Eaves prevent rainwater from leaking down the walls and into the structure.Protection Against Pests: Properly maintained eaves can hinder bugs from getting in the roofing system and attic spaces.Aesthetic Appeal: Well-maintained eaves contribute to the total appearance of the home, boosting curb appeal.
In spite of their value, eaves are frequently overlooked in routine home maintenance regimens.
Common Issues with Eaves
Like any part of a home, eaves can come across numerous issues that may result in serious damage if left unaddressed. Some typical issues consist of:
